Try 'Push the Boat Out' at Dovestones Sailing Club
Date published: 19 February 2018
Try out sailing and yachting at Dovestones Reservoir
Anyone thinking of taking to the water in 2018 should look no further than Dovestone Sailing Club.
The club has a series of dates this Spring where experienced instructors will show novice sailors the ropes.
Before you know it you will be on your way to becoming an expert.
The club is a registered Royal Yachting Association (RYA) training centre.
All boats are provided by the club - you’ll only need waterproofs.
This years dates are:
April 28/29 - RYA Level 1/2 course.
May 13 - Push the Boat Out. This is effectively an open day, but any visitor wanting to sail should contact the club first to ensure a place is available. There is no charge.
May 19/20 - RYA Dinghy Sailing Level 1.
June 16/17 - RYA Dinghy Sailing Level 2.
